London shopkeeper fights back after masked robber pulls gun

This is the moment a screaming shopkeeper hurls a confectionery stand to fight off a masked gunman attempting to rob his London store.

CCTV footage shows a hoodedman enter an off-licence in Shadwell at 11.10pm on Tuesday.

The man, posing as a customer, says to the man standing alone behind the till: “Hello, my friend, have you got a black bag.”

The vendor, in his 40s, appears confused and asks him to repeat the question as the robber whips out a gun.

Reacting quickly the defenceless shopkeeper launches into a fit of screams and hurls a rack of chocolate bars at the gunman.

The startled robber uses the black pistol to strike the vendor in the head before fleeing the store.

Armed officers conducted a search for the gunman but no arrests have been made so far.

A Met spokeswoman said police were called to the incident at 11.13pm.

“The suspect, who was reported to be holding a firearm, then fled the scene.

“A man aged in his 40s was treated for a head injury at hospital. His injury was not life threatening.”

Enquiries are continuing.
